#614bf5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#614bf5 is composed of 38% red, 29.4% green and 96.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.4% cyan, 69.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 247.8 degrees, a saturation of 89.5% and a lightness of 62.7%. #614bf5 color hex could be obtained by blending #c296ff with #0000eb. Closest websafe color is: #6633ff.

Shades and Tints of #614bf5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010006 is the darkest color, while #f4f2fe is the lightest one.
